Safety-Related Changes Two new columns have been added to the logbook: "Wind Speed Range (MPH)" and Gusts (MPH). These are mandatory items to be filled out by the keyed member who signs out the boat. The New Castle Sailing Club website home page has this information in the WindAlert section. WindAlert also has a mobile app for your smartphone. We want to ensure that you know the forecasted wind speed during the anticipated duration of your sail and weigh that information against your own and your crew's experience and ability before you decide to sail...or not. By the way, the club's website home page also has the weather forecast and weather radar by Accuweather. Be sure to check them out before hitting the road to go for a sail. Masthead flotation devices have been added to all the Flying Scots this season to help prevent the Scots from turning turtle in a capsize. These triangular-shaped soft foam devices will be attached to the main halyard for the duration of the sailing season. We don't think they will noticeably affect sailing performance but they make putting the mainsail cover on a little harder because of their bulk. Please do not try to remove them. Because the main halyards will remain attached to the mainsail, noodles will no longer be used on the Scots at the mooring (see photos). See you on Launch Day! 5 News from our Racing Director Introduction to the 2017 Racing Program This is a quick introduction to the 2017 racing program. Since it is fundamentally no different from last season you can stop reading right now if you went out for Saturday races last year. We re opening the season with two specialty races: the Captain s Race on Sunday April 30, and the make-up 2016 DELRIPETT on Saturday, May 6. Then on Saturday, May 13, the regular season begins with the first race of the Spring Series. Details are in the club calendar on the web site. You only need to remember that the skipper s meeting is always at 9:00 a.m. (except when it s not, like for the DELRIPETT). So you want to be at the sail house at the end of Battery Park (not the club house) by about 8:30 a.m. to sign in. If you are keyed, and want to skipper a boat, you sign in as a skipper. Otherwise, you sign in as crew. Rather than go into long winded explanations here, just show up and the race committee will show you the ropes. Our race committees are specially trained to be friendly and helpful. These races are open to everybody if you aren t keyed you can still crew, and new members are encouraged to attend. Some skippers line up their crews in advance, others show up and team up with whomever is there. Amazingly, it always works. Very seldom, and I mean very, very, very seldom, do we have to turn anybody away. And then there s always room on the committee boat. The regular season, by which I mean those races that count toward the club championship, consists of two series, spring and fall, and two fleets, silver and gold. Each series consists of six races, assuming we don t have to cancel any races for weather or attendance reasons. The gold and silver fleets sail together and are scored together. The only outward differentiator is that the gold fleet contends for the club championship, and the silver fleet contends for the novice trophy. Membership in the gold fleet is based on a) results in prior years and b) my arbitrary determination. It means that the gold fleet contenders are those that take their racing way too seriously and can get a little bit over-competitive. The silver fleet contenders are more relaxed and just show up to have a good time. We actually created the silver fleet so we would have a safe space for members that are not looking for competitive pressure on a Saturday morning, but still want to learn to race a sailboat. Or to put it another way: it s OK if you screw up once in a while. Your skipper isn t contending for the club championship anyway, so you can t hurt his or her chances no matter how hard you try. Technically, service on the race committee is required for everyone who is competing for the Club Championship, but actually we need to require it of everyone who participates halfway regularly in the racing program, and even then we would only fill a fraction of the slots. So we need everyone to chip in. If I don't get enough volunteers this season I'll do what I've been threatening to do for years: implement the nuclear option and just write names into the spreadsheet and bully people into turning up. For new members (if you're still reading this you're almost certainly a new member, nobody else cares about my rants)... so anyway, if you're a new member, participating on race committee is an interesting and rewarding experience. You learn how the racing program works (setting a starting line, setting the course, starting procedures, etc.) you see the racing program from close up without getting your backside wet, and you can observe different tactics, strategies, and boat handling methods much better than when you're in a race boat, and you get to use the VHF radio. Experience is not required, because we will always pair you with an experienced member who will show you the ropes.
